Daikin in San Leandro
San Leandro is mostly post-war suburban single-family, and the houses are typically on their second or third HVAC system while the ductwork underneath is still original. That shapes every Daikin job here. We are factory-trained on Daikin, but on these homes the equipment is the second decision. The first is whether the ducts can carry a modern inverter system's airflow. We test leakage on every install estimate, and above 25 percent we price sealing or replacement because a good Daikin on bad ducts will not give you the performance you paid for.
Where the ducts are sound, the Daikin Fit ducted heat pump is a clean replacement for the aging gas-furnace-and-AC pairs we find here. San Leandro's mild East Bay climate, cooler near the bay and warmer inland, means both heating and cooling matter, and the inverter handles both without oversizing. Where ducts are beyond saving, Daikin ductless is the more honest path than spending money to replace ductwork that the home's layout never really suited.
The brand call here usually comes down to budget, and we are direct about it. Daikin is the premium choice; Goodman, its sister brand, runs similar inverter design for less. On San Leandro budgets that gap matters, so we quote both side by side. We also still find late-1990s and early-2000s R-22 systems in service. Reclaimed R-22 is uneconomical to keep feeding, so when one of those leaks we run the Daikin replacement numbers rather than chasing the leak.
Daikin work we do in San Leandro
Duct test before any Daikin install. Original San Leandro ducts often leak past 25 percent. We test on the estimate and put the sealing or replacement cost on paper alongside the Daikin equipment, so you see the true number rather than discovering it after the install underperforms.
R-22 system to Daikin replacement. Late-90s and early-2000s R-22 systems are still running in San Leandro. When one leaks we price a Daikin Fit heat pump on R-454B instead of feeding expensive reclaimed refrigerant into a unit at the end of its life.
Daikin ductless where ducts are dead. On homes where the original ductwork is past saving and the layout never suited it, we install Daikin ductless rather than spend the budget rebuilding ducts. Single or multi-zone depending on the rooms that actually need it.
Standard inverter service calls. Capacitor failures in summer, ignitor and control-board issues, and inverter faults on newer Daikin units are the routine work. Our Daikin parts access means board and sensor replacements arrive fast instead of leaving you without heat or cooling for a week.
